This topic is about the position of a light sith in the dark side oriented empire.

 

It is hinted in the game that every other light side sith (aside from the player only) is actualy being hunted down by the sith and they are trying to remain in hiding but they usualy fail to do so.

 

This does not however apply to the player warrior/inquisitor.

Aside from snarky remarks about you being too nice to people theres no threath or anything.

The player is pretty much allowed to be light without the need of hiding it.

 

The Inquisitor is already being hunted during their class story for other, more pressing reasons. That's until they kill a Dark Council member in front of the rest of the Dark Council, and pretty easily. No one is going to mess with Darth Imperius, especially since Marr likes Darth Imperius behavior.

 

The Warrior - heavy Light Side doesn't make any sense here because of Chapter III but the Warrior is at first carrying out missions only answerable to Baras (who has other priorities) and then is the f'ing Emperor's Wrath, who is both believed to be carrying out direct requests from the Emperor and is by definition has to be able to kill any Darth that mouths off.

 

Random Sith Lord: "I can sense you dabble in the Light Side of the Force."

Warrior: "I can sense you are destined to be in two pieces."

I think you're mistaken. Outright murder of another Sith is frowned upon. Subtle murders made to look like accidents or don't have any ties back to you is considered the way to go. A Sith is supposed to be cunning. That being said, there are two Sith positions that throw this out the window. One being the Emperor's Wrath and the other is the position that enables you to slay heretics (aka Light Side Sith.) Jaesa has the lawful authority to kill another Sith in front of hundreds of witnesses if she has proof that said sith is following and practicing the light side. That is because the Sith believe the dark side is the dominant side of the force and that the light side should be purged.

 

It is why Sidious was attempting to spread the darkside throughout the galaxy and eradicate the light entirely. A Sith likely won't kill you for just being a Sith. Most Sith kill other Sith for political gain, removing a threat, etc. You will be killed as a Sith for simply practicing the light side. Both the Light Side warrior and Light Side inquisitor make it a point of having to hide and keep it a secret. Using words like "Infiltrate" or "Change from Within." You're an inside agent surrounded by enemies. You are a heretic.

I can concede many Siths will see light as weak, enough that you'd have many zealots (like DS Jaessa :p ) running after you . But it is still power Siths are after, not darkness

“Peace is a lie. There is only passion.

Through Passion, I gain strength.

Through Strength, I gain Power.

Through Power, I gain Victory.

Through Victory, my chains are broken.

The Force shall set me free.”

-The Sith Code
